When Victor Hugo died in 1885, the world was shocked to discover that he had a lone survivor: his daughter Adßele, incarcerated in an asylum for insane gentlewomen. Adßele Hugo was an accomplished, intelligent, and ambitious young woman whose potential shrank with every year spent under her tyrannical father's roof. At thirty-three, she fell desperately in love with an English soldier who was only interested in her money. Leslie Smith Dow recounts Adßele's nine-year pursuit of her unwilling lover from Guernsey to Halifax to Barbados, her return to her father's sphere, and the progressive schizophrenia that finally incapacitated her. Smith Dow bases Adßele's stranger-than-fiction history on her bizarre diaries, her family's letters, and the testimony of eyewitnesses.
